Memorial Services Scheduled for the Rev. Harmon Gehr
- Share via
Memorial services are scheduled for 2 p.m. May 3, at Pasadena’s Throop Memorial Unitarian-Universalist Church for the church’s former minister, the Rev. Harmon M. Gehr.
Gehr, who died March 20 at the age of 89, had served the church at 300 S. Los Robles Ave., Pasadena, from 1956 until his retirement in 1973.
A former violinist with the Cleveland Symphony, Gehr often supplemented his Sunday sermons by playing violin solos from the pulpit. Within the community, he was particularly known for his efforts to integrate Pasadena schools and the city’s police and fire departments.
